- [ ] Step 7: Archive cold storage buckets (Glacierline tier). Confirm both ceremony witnesses are present, verify bucket manifests match the Oxbow ledger, then seal the archive key shares. Plugin authors may observe but not handle shares. Once sealed, the archive index itself is encrypted and can only be reopened with the passphrase below.

vault phrase of badup-hahig = tamael-aldael-kelmir-istael-fenok-istwyn-tamius-jorath-oliion

Env Vars for the Brokkwire Upgrade (plugin authors, read this!). We're moving from Brokkwire 2 to 3, and a few knobs changed: QUEUE_PREFIX is now mandatory, HEARTBEAT_SECS defaults to 20, and RETRY_BACKOFF takes milliseconds now, not seconds. Your plugins get these injected automatically, so don't hardcode anything. One more thing: the broker connection credential has to sit on the line right after this sentence.

env line for fafof-fahag: LEDGER_TOKEN5=f8790

Subject: VRAMscope profiler update

Welcome, new folks. VRAMscope now samples GPU allocations per kernel launch, so memory spikes are attributable to specific ops. Please profile any model change before merging and attach the report to your review. The profiler version used for this cycle is pinned below.

session token of taduf-tahog = htk4_91a1

Hey — handing off the spreadsheet export thing on Quillbox before I'm out. Short version: big exports (50k+ rows) balloon heap because we build the whole workbook in memory. I've got a streaming writer half-done on the feature branch; it cuts peak usage by roughly 70% in my tests. Don't ship Otterbay 4.2 with the old path enabled for enterprise tenants. Remaining work: cell styling and the retry wrapper. Profiling numbers, flame graphs, and my notes are all on the page below.

wiki page, tahaf-tajog: https://jira.ordindyn.corp/pipeline